Reading stories to children is a great way to develop and encourage young children to read books for themselves in the long term. It can increase their vocabulary and listening skills not to mention triggering their imagination.
Listening – this is a vital skill for children to develop. An interesting story whether from a book or told from memory, will capture children’s attention and encourage their ability to listen attentively.
Through drama and role play the children are encouraged to physically and imaginatively express themselves. |
